When USC instituted a new football practice policy in August barring media members from reporting injuries, it joined a number of its Pac-12 counterparts in the clampdown of information in the name of maintaining a competitive advantage. USC now prohibits the reporting of injuries observed during in-season practices — much like conference foes, such as […]

USC coach Lane Kiffin announced Sunday that media members would no longer be allowed to report practice injuries of any sort, saying it put USC at a competitive disadvantage. So the general public will no longer know which Trojans sat out practice, which ones appeared to be hurt or which ones spent their day on […]
